  • Patent number: 11612848
    Abstract: A scrubbing assembly for treating malodorous air by chemical scrubbing one or more chemical components from an influent airflow, particularly one or more chemical components that have become airborne from chemical intervention solutions used during food processing, such as vapors from peroxycarboxylic acid solutions used during food processing. The peroxycarboxylic acid vapors are removed from air in a continuous manner within the scrubber assembly utilizing a neutralizing chemical solution to provide a treated effluent airflow that can be returned back to the point of use area from which the malodorous air was removed for treatment.

  • Patent number: 5419521
    Abstract: A three-axis stabilized platform is disclosed wherein the azimuth, or train axis, a cross-level axis and an elevation axis intersect each other at a substantially common pivot point. Each axis supports a pivotable member which includes sensing and drive means for correcting the position of that member to maintain the direction of an antenna toward an aiming point in space. Azimuth post rotates or pivots about the azimuth or train axis and is cantilevered from a support base so that the post extends vertically and radially inwardly from the base to provide pivot supports at its outer end and in planes perpendicular to each other and perpendicular to the plane of the azimuth axis.

  • Patent number: 4582291
    Abstract: A compositely statically balanced mechanically stabilized platform system including a stabilizing platform having at least one pivotal axis, an equipment platform, a supporting structure, a pendulum, non-rigid means for orienting the platform with respect to the pendulum, a gyro assembly mounted for rotation about a precession axis perpendicular to a pivotal axis of the platform. The gyro assembly itself is statically balanced about its precession axis and has restraining means for orienting the spin axis of the gyro with respect to the gyro assembly supports. The system further includes an equipment platform preferably mounted remotely from the platform and mechanically connected thereto by a linkage assembly which transmits motion of the stabilizing assembly to the equipment platform. In one embodiment the system is constructed as a single integrated unit. In several embodiments the gyro azimuth frame is supported on bearings which permit unrestrained rotation in the azimuth plane.
